PESHAWAR: A suicide attack targeting police in Peshawar late Sunday wounded five officers and badly damaged a vehicle, officials said.

The bomber struck a police patrol in Dera Ismail Khan town in Khyber Pakhtunkhwa

"The suicide bomber was on foot. He blew himself up when the police vehicle was patrolling in a street," senior police official Qazi Jamil ur-Rehman told AFP.

"Five policemen were wounded, condition of one of them was critical," he said.
